From 47a7baf09dc230c19e9b3f01b449570b3ac11fbe Mon Sep 17 00:00:00 2001
From: client_Wu Xijin <364452445@qq.com>
Date: 星期六, 30 三月 2019 15:06:27 +0800
Subject: [PATCH] Merge branch 'master' of http://192.168.0.87:10010/r/snxxz_scripts

---
 System/Auction/AuctionInquiry.cs |   53 +++++++++++------------------------------------------
 1 files changed, 11 insertions(+), 42 deletions(-)

diff --git a/System/Auction/AuctionInquiry.cs b/System/Auction/AuctionInquiry.cs
index 7d4b38f..8045e62 100644
--- a/System/Auction/AuctionInquiry.cs
+++ b/System/Auction/AuctionInquiry.cs
@@ -93,49 +93,16 @@
                 locationGuid = itemGUID;
                 WindowCenter.Instance.Open<AuctionHouseWin>(true, 1);
             }
+            else if (model.BiddingItemInfoDic.ContainsKey(itemGUID))
+            {
+                locationGuid = itemGUID;
+                WindowCenter.Instance.Open<AuctionHouseWin>(true, 0);
+            }
             else
             {
-                SendLocationQuery(itemGUID);
+                SendQueryTagAuctionItem(itemGUID);
             }
         }
-
-        private void SendLocationQuery(string itemGUID)//瀹氫綅鏌ヨ
-        {
-            if (auctionHelpModel.SelectedGenreNow != 0)
-            {
-                auctionHelpModel.SelectedGenreNow = 0;
-            }
-            int indexId = GetInquiryIndex();
-            var auctionIndex = AuctionIndexConfig.Get(indexId);
-            if (auctionIndex == null)
-            {
-                DebugEx.LogError("鎷嶅崠绱㈠紩琛ㄦ病鏈夋煡鍒板搴旂殑ID" + indexId);
-                return;
-            }
-            QueryAuctionItem queryAuctionItem = new QueryAuctionItem();
-            queryAuctionItem.FromItemGUID = itemGUID;
-            queryAuctionItem.Job = auctionIndex.Job;
-            queryAuctionItem.ItemTypeList = new List<uint>();
-            if (auctionIndex.ItemType != null && auctionIndex.ItemType.Length > 0)
-            {
-                for (int i = 0; i < auctionIndex.ItemType.Length; i++)
-                {
-                    queryAuctionItem.ItemTypeList.Add((uint)auctionIndex.ItemType[i]);
-                }
-            }
-            queryAuctionItem.ClassLV = auctionIndex.Order;
-            queryAuctionItem.SpecItemIDList = new List<uint>();
-            if (auctionIndex.SpecItemID != null && auctionIndex.SpecItemID.Length > 0)
-            {
-                for (int i = 0; i < auctionIndex.SpecItemID.Length; i++)
-                {
-                    queryAuctionItem.SpecItemIDList.Add((uint)auctionIndex.SpecItemID[i]);
-                }
-            }
-            queryAuctionItem.QueryDir = 3;//瀹氫綅鏌ヨ
-            queryAuctionItem.QueryCount = 10;
-            SendQueryAuctionItem(queryAuctionItem);
-        }
 
         private void SendQueryAuctionItem(QueryAuctionItem queryAuctionItem)//鎷嶅崠琛屾煡璇㈡媿鍗栦腑鐨勭墿鍝�
         {
@@ -176,10 +143,12 @@
             CB516_tagCGQueryAttentionAuctionItem cb516 = new CB516_tagCGQueryAttentionAuctionItem();
             GameNetSystem.Instance.SendInfo(cb516);
         }
-        public void SendQueryTagAuctionItem()//鎷嶅崠琛屾煡璇㈠畾浣嶇洰鏍囨媿鍝�
+
+        public void SendQueryTagAuctionItem(string guid)//鎷嶅崠琛屾煡璇㈠畾浣嶇洰鏍囨媿鍝�
         {
-            CB517_tagCGQueryTagAuctionItem cb517 = new CB517_tagCGQueryTagAuctionItem();
-            GameNetSystem.Instance.SendInfo(cb517);
+            var pak = new CB517_tagCGQueryTagAuctionItem();
+            pak.ItemGUID = guid;
+            GameNetSystem.Instance.SendInfo(pak);
         }
 
         public void SendSellAuctionItem(int itemIndex)//鎷嶅崠琛屼笂鏋舵媿鍝�

--
Gitblit v1.8.0